Big Tech AI spending is eating into stock buybacks, hitting lowest level since 2019
Alphabet, Microsoft, Amazon, and Meta spent the least on combined share repurchases last quarter than in any quarter since 2019 as they race to invest in AI. Alphabet and Microsoft spent roughly $11B on buybacks, while Amazon and Meta held off entirely. Amazon hasn't bought back stock since 2022.
The shift reflects how aggressively Big Tech is redirecting cash toward AI infrastructure. The trend is notable for investors who have relied on buybacks as a key return mechanism from these companies.
